Sourced from rollup's changelog.

2.32.0

2020-10-16

Features

  • Extend preserveEntrySignatures with a value "exports-only" to allow extension only if an entry does not have exports (#3823)

Pull Requests

2.31.0

2020-10-15

Features

  • When using the output.moduleToStringTag option, also add the tag to entries with exports and simulated external namespaces (#3822)
  • Add the __esModule interop marker to IIFE global variables unless output.esModule is turned off (#3822)

Pull Requests

2.30.0

2020-10-13

Features

  • Add moduleParsed hook that is called for each module once code and AST are available (#3813)
  • Include code and AST in this.getModuleInfo (#3813)

Bug Fixes

  • Provide the original Acorn AST instead of the internal one when resolving dynamic imports that contain non-trivial expressions (#3813)

Pull Requests

2.29.0

2020-10-08

Features

  • Allow passing custom options to other plugins via this.resolve (#3807)
  • Allow attaching custom meta information to modules when resolving, loading or transforming (#3807)
  • Do not throw but return null when using this.getModuleInfo for an unknown id (#3807)

Bug Fixes

  • Trigger build in watch mode when files are added to a watched directory (#3812)
  • Make code optional when transforming modules (#3807)
